Elder Morgan Lee Farmer, age 74, passed away October 23, 2020. He worked for many years as a Shipfitter. He also served as a Pastor for over 40 years and currently pastored at Salem Missionary Baptist Church in Leaf, Mississippi. He greatly enjoyed spending time with his family and especially his grandchildren. He was a devoted husband, loving father and granddaddy. He will be greatly missed.
He is preceded in death by his parents, William “Bill” and Virgie Lee Farmer; son, John David Farmer and daughter, Virgie Rene’ Farmer.
Those left to cherish his memory include his loving wife of 55 years, Mary Ann McLeod Farmer; children Wendy (Lamar) Pearce, Morgan (Rebekah) Farmer, Donna (Joey) Neumann, Michael (Naomi) Farmer, Stephen (Tina) Farmer, Danny (Ashley) Farmer, Joel Farmer, Elizabeth Boone, Ronnie (Evelyn) Farmer, Deborah Colson and Charlene (Brent) Miller; 54 grandchildren, 6 great grandchildren; brother, Billy (Muriel) Farmer; sisters, Glenna Pearson and Beth (Bob) Lee; numerous other relatives and friends.
